#39ef5d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#39ef5d is composed of 22.4% red, 93.7% green and 36.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 76.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 61.1%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 131.9 degrees, a saturation of 85% and a lightness of 58%. #39ef5d color hex could be obtained by blending #72ffba with #00df00. Closest websafe color is: #33ff66.

Shades and Tints of #39ef5d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000200 is the darkest color, while #eefef1 is the lightest one.

Tones of #39ef5d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#949494 is the less saturated color, while #31f758 is the most saturated one.
